Transaction dd6d34c1bcebf8bdf721a925c04ec4b12e77c0fa880242e797919ef6fb51e2e8
1 Input
1 Output
-
dd6d34c1bcebf8bdf721a925c04ec4b12e77c0fa880242e797919ef6fb51e2e8:0
- value
- 13072500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b8e3ad5a66282f6d016fe43f3fe9ee96fe9f2960 OP_EQUAL
- address
- 3JYd18KVLKtzawDMqEx5piojj5ZAczoZEt